Your Ultimate Guide to Finding the Best Headphones for Your Workouts

Getting the right headphones for your fitness routine makes a huge difference. They keep you motivated, block out distractions, and simply make exercising more enjoyable. This guide will help you choose the perfect pair.

Why Special Fitness Headphones?

Regular headphones might fall out or get damaged by sweat. Fitness headphones are built tough. They stay put and handle moisture better.

Key Features to Look For

When you’re shopping, keep these important features in mind.

1. Secure Fit and Comfort

Earbuds
  • Wingtips or Ear Hooks: These little helpers grab onto your ear to keep earbuds from slipping. They are great for running or jumping.
  • Different Ear Tip Sizes: Good headphones come with various sizes of soft silicone tips. You can pick the ones that fit your ears best. A snug fit also helps block outside noise.
Over-Ear/On-Ear Headphones
  • Adjustable Headband: A headband that adjusts lets you find the perfect fit. It stops the headphones from feeling too tight or too loose.
  • Padded Earcups: Soft cushions make headphones comfortable to wear for a long time. They also help seal out noise.

2. Sweat and Water Resistance

Look for an IP rating. This tells you how well the headphones resist water and dust. An IPX4 rating means they can handle sweat and light rain. Higher ratings are even better.

3. Battery Life

You don’t want your music to stop halfway through your workout. Aim for headphones that offer at least 5-8 hours of playtime on a single charge. Some can last much longer!

4. Durability

Fitness headphones need to be strong. They might get tossed in a gym bag or dropped. Look for sturdy materials that can handle some wear and tear.

5. Connectivity

  • Bluetooth: Wireless headphones give you freedom to move without tangled cords. Make sure they have a stable Bluetooth connection.
  • Multipoint Pairing: This lets you connect to two devices at once, like your phone and your watch.

6. Sound Quality

While not the top priority for all fitness users, good sound makes workouts better. You want clear music to keep you going.

Important Materials

The materials used affect comfort and durability.

  • Silicone or Rubber: These are common for ear tips and earbud coatings. They offer a good grip and resist sweat.
  • Lightweight Plastics: Many headphones use strong but light plastics. This keeps them from feeling heavy on your head or in your ears.
  • Breathable Fabric: For over-ear headphones, breathable fabric on the earcups prevents your ears from getting too hot.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about how you’ll use your headphones.

For Runners and Cardio Enthusiasts

Lightweight earbuds with secure wingtips or ear hooks are best. They need to be sweatproof and have good battery life for long runs. Wireless is almost a must.

For Gym Goers

Over-ear or on-ear headphones can offer better noise cancellation, helping you focus. They should still be sweat-resistant and comfortable for extended wear. Earbuds are also a popular choice here.

For Water Sports

If you swim or do other water activities, you’ll need fully waterproof headphones. These are a special category and often have a different design.


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What is the most important feature for fitness headphones?

A: A secure and comfortable fit is the most important feature. If they don’t stay in your ears or on your head, they won’t be useful.

Q: Are wireless headphones better for workouts?

A: Yes, wireless Bluetooth headphones give you more freedom to move without cords getting in the way.

Q: How much sweat resistance do I need?

A: For most workouts, an IPX4 rating is good. If you sweat a lot or work out in the rain, look for a higher rating like IPX5 or IPX7.

Q: Can I use regular headphones for the gym?

A: You can, but they might not fit well, get damaged by sweat, or have tangled cords. Fitness headphones are designed to avoid these problems.

Q: How long should the battery last?

A: Aim for at least 5-8 hours of playtime. Longer is always better if you have long workout sessions.

Q: Do I need noise-canceling headphones for fitness?

A: It’s not required, but noise-canceling can help you focus by blocking out gym noise or traffic. Some people prefer to hear their surroundings for safety.

Q: What are wingtips?

A: WIngtips are small, flexible pieces that stick out from earbuds. They help hold the earbuds securely in your ears.

Q: How do I clean my fitness headphones?

A: Always check the manufacturer’s instructions. Usually, you can wipe them down with a slightly damp cloth. Avoid getting water into charging ports.

Q: Are over-ear headphones good for running?

A: Over-ear headphones can be a bit heavy and warm for running. Earbuds are generally preferred by runners.

Q: What is an IP rating?

A: An IP rating (Ingress Protection) tells you how well a device is protected against dust and water. The higher the numbers, the better the protection.
